def start_socket(): global sock global pool2 while True: try: pool2 = ConnectionPool('MINDNET', ['79.143.185.3:9160'], timeout=10000000000) mdTb.start_db(pool2) get_object.start_db(pool2) get_object2.start_db(pool2) Identify.start_db(pool2) except Exception, e: print 'Not connected(cassandra)....', e time.sleep(5) continue break
def start_db(pool2): global tb_object global tb_object_dt global tb_relaction global tb_object31 global tb_object_dt31 global tb_relaction31 #======== tb_object =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T3') tb_object_dt =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T_DT3') tb_relaction = pycassa.ColumnFamily(pool2, 'SEMANTIC_RELACTIONS3') # tb_object31 =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T3_1_4') tb_object_dt31 =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T_DT3_1_4') tb_relaction31 = pycassa.ColumnFamily(pool2, 'SEMANTIC_RELACTIONS3_1_4') # tb_object1 =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T') tb_object_dt1 =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T_DT') tb_relaction1 = pycassa.ColumnFamily(pool2, 'SEMANTIC_RELACTIONS') # mdTb.start_db(pool2)
import datetime ''' import conn conn= conn.conn_mx ''' import pycassa from pycassa.pool import ConnectionPool from pycassa import index from pycassa.columnfamily import ColumnFamily pool2 = ConnectionPool('MINDNET', ['79.143.185.3:9160'], timeout=10000) import mdTb mdTb.start_db(pool2) tb_object =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T3') tb_object_dt = pycassa.ColumnFamily(pool2, 'SEMANTIC_OBJECT_DT3') tb_relaction = pycassa.ColumnFamily(pool2, 'SEMANTIC_RELACTIONS3') # producao w_cache3 = pycassa.ColumnFamily(pool2, 'web_cache1') # testes #w_cache3 = pycassa.ColumnFamily(pool2, 'web_cache3') entry_doc = [] fs_teste = True tw_server = False # se indexa por outra servidor, abrir conn2